Studio Technologies Model 65 Bass Manager Details Bass
Manager for 5.1 Surround (Analog) The Model 65 Bass Manager
is designed to enhance the monitoring of multi-channel audio sources during the
recording, mixing, mastering, and distribution process. The Model 65 is
applicable for any multi-channel monitoring environment where some or all
channels are not supported with loudspeakers having extended low-frequency
response. Resources are included in the Model 65 to make it appropriate for
cinema, music, and broadcast applications. The Model 65's design is oriented
toward directly supporting 5.1-type applications. The five main channels are
full bandwidth, and use the industry-standard designation of left, center,
right, left surround, and right surround. The ".1" channel is
designated as LFE, which is also referred to as low-frequency effects,
"boom," or subwoofer. The LFE term originated in cinema formats but
is now part of music and broadcast formats as well.
The overall goal of the
Model 65 is very simple: Ensure that the entire audio bandwidth of all channels
can be accurately monitored. Many loudspeaker systems have inherent
low-frequency limitations, preventing a true picture of the source material
from being presented. To overcome this, the low-frequency energy from the five
main channels can be separated and then routed to one or more subwoofer
loudspeakers. The Model 65 includes filters to accomplish this, providing a
smooth and sonically pleasing crossover of signals being routed to the main and
subwoofer loudspeakers.
The Model 65 also
supports several format-specific parameters required for accurate LFE channel
monitoring. To minimize digital bandwidth, some multi-channel formats restrict
the frequency response of the LFE channel. To emulate this process, a low-pass
filter can be inserted into the LFE signal chain. For compatibility with some
cinema formats, gain can also be added to the LFE signal.
While the Model 65 is
intended primarily for use in 5.1 applications, additional specialized features
and capabilities are also included. This allows the unit to be configured to
meet the needs of a broad range of monitoring applications.
Main Inputs
The Model 65 contains
five full-bandwidth input channels, which are intended for connection to left,
center, right, left surround, and right surround sources. The electronically
balanced inputs are compatible with balanced or unbalanced sources. Associated
with each of the five main inputs is a crossover circuit, created by means of
separate high- and low-pass filters. The filters are factory-configured to
provide a crossover frequency of 80 Hz. The output of each high-pass filter is
routed to the output circuit of its corresponding channel. The output of each
low-pass filter can be individually assigned to subwoofer output 1, subwoofer
output 2, or subwoofer outputs 1 and 2. To prevent level build up, the signal
is attenuated 6 dB when assigned to both subwoofer outputs.
LFE Input
The Model 65 contains an
input channel that is specifically intended for connection to an LFE source. To
simulate some multi-channel formats, a low-pass filter can be inserted, using a
front-panel switch or remote control signal, into the LFE signal path. The
filter, created by cascading four 2nd order low-pass sections, provides a 48
dB-per-octave slope with the –6 dB point at 120 Hz. To allow accurate
monitoring of some formats, a front-panel switch allows 10 dB of gain to be
added to the LFE signal. This ensures that the proper relative level is
maintained between the LFE signal and the low-frequency energy derived from the
main inputs. As with the main inputs, the LFE signal can be assigned to
subwoofer output 1, subwoofer output 2, or subwoofer outputs 1 and 2.
Outputs
The Model 65 provides
five main and two subwoofer outputs. Each of the outputs is electronically
balanced and can be connected to balanced or unbalanced loads. To minimize the
chance of loudspeaker damage, power up/power down mute relays are associated
with each output. The nominal level of the five main outputs is +4 dBu,
maintaining a unity gain input-to-output relationship. The two subwoofer outputs
are handled somewhat differently, having nominal output levels of -6 dBu. This
reduced operating level allows sufficient audio headroom when phase coherent
signals from the main inputs are routed, by way of the low-pass filters, to the
subwoofer outputs.
Support for Two Subwoofers
As previously discussed,
the outputs of the high-pass filters associated with the five main inputs are
routed to the five main outputs. The outputs of the low-pass filters associated
with the five main inputs, along with the LFE signal, can be assigned to either
or both of the subwoofer outputs. The two subwoofer outputs allow flexibility
when designing a loudspeaker system. A system could be configured to support
subwoofers that are position-oriented, such as "sub left front" and
"sub right front." Or, the subwoofers could be configured according
to program content, such has having subwoofer 1 handle only LFE information,
while subwoofer 2 handles the low-passed signals from the main inputs.
Bass Management Bypass
A Model 65 feature allows
the bass management function to be disabled by means of a front-panel switch.
This function can be useful, especially during the monitor system installation
and room-tuning process. When the bypass function is enabled, the main input
signals route directly to the main outputs. In addition, the outputs of the
low-pass filters associated with the main inputs no longer route to either of
the subwoofer outputs. However, when the bass management bypass function is
active the LFE signal continues its normal flow to one or both of the subwoofer
outputs.
Remote Control
Three remote control
functions are available: remote LFE low-pass filter, remote LFE mute, and
remote subwoofer output mono. The remote control functions are specifically
provided for use during the recording or mixing process. An effective
installation could utilize foot switches or console-mounted buttons to allow
easy operator access to the remote functions.
Remote control of the LFE
low-pass filter allows real-time confirmation of LFE content. Some release
formats require that LFE program content be band restricted. Under this
condition, a valid audio mix would have no change in its sonic character when
the LFE low-pass filter is activated.
When remote LFE mute is
active, normal bass management operation continues, but the LFE signal is not
routed to either of the subwoofer outputs. This function allows a direct check
of the impact an LFE signal is having on an overall mix.
The remote subwoofer
output mono function is provided to allow confirmation of the phase-coherency
of the two subwoofer outputs. When the function is enabled, the subwoofer
signals are combined (summed), attenuated by 6 dB, and fed to both subwoofers.
Expansion Capability
Provision has been made
to allow multiple Model 65 units to be easily interconnected. Using two units,
ten main and two LFE inputs are supported, as well as providing ten main and
two subwoofer output channels. For other special applications a virtually
unlimited number of units can be interconnected.
Flexibility
The Model 65 is designed
to be used directly "out of the box," providing effective bass
management for most 5.1 applications. However, installation-specific
requirements, along with the evolving world of multi-channel audio, make
flexibility imperative. With the Model 65 you can use it "our way,"
or easily perform a minor or major reconfiguration. A competent technician can
field-adjust a number of key bass management parameters. The high- and low-pass
filter frequencies associated with the main inputs can be individually
adjusted. This allows the crossover frequencies to be configured on a
channel-by-channel basis. While the factory default crossover frequency is set
for nominally 80 Hz, selecting an alternate crossover frequency, symmetrical or
asymmetrical, is simple. To adjust any of these filters requires only changing
resistors. Sockets are present in the Model 65's circuit board, eliminating the
need to solder.
The high- and low-pass
filters associated with the main inputs are implemented by cascading 2nd order
Sallen-Key filter circuits. Jumpers on the Model 65's circuit board allow
individual selection of 12 dB/octave or 24 dB/octave response. The
factory-default configuration for the high-pass filters is 12 dB/octave,
complementing the internal filters contained in many amplified loudspeaker
systems. Other speaker systems may benefit from the use of the 24 dB/octave
setting. In addition, a third jumper position allows the input signal to be
directly routed to the output. This "flat" selection supports
loudspeaker systems that already contain filters to provide the desired
high-pass response. As for the low-pass filters, the factory configuration is
24 dB/octave, supporting the needs of many subwoofer loudspeakers. Alternately,
the 12 dB/octave settings can be used to match the Model 65 with other monitor
systems.
Installation
The Model 65 mounts in
one space of a standard 19-inch rack. Mains input voltage is factory selected
for 100, 120, or 220/240 V, 50/60 Hz, operation. The Model 65's input connector
is directly compatible with Studio Technologies StudioComm 68A/69A Surround
Monitoring System. The channel layout arrangements of the two systems are
identical, making interconnection simple. Other input sources are easily
interfaced using wiring compatible with the industry-standard 25-pin connection
scheme. The seven out-puts connect to the monitor amplifiers, or amplified
loudspeakers, using standard 3-pin XLR-type cables. Each Model 65 also contains
a 9-pin D-subminiature connector. Pins on this "D-sub" are used to
provide access to the remote control functions as well as link multiple Model
65s.
